Affymax Completes Enrollment in PEARL 1, the First of Four Phase 3 Clinical Trials of Hematide(TM) to Treat Anemia in Chronic Renal Failure Patients

www.affymax.com - Affymax, Inc. (Nasdaq:AFFY) today announced that enrollment has been completed in the first of four Phase 3 clinical trials of its lead investigational therapy, Hematide(TM), which is being evaluated for the treatment of anemia in chronic renal failure patients. PEARL 1 (Phase 3 Evaluation of Hematide for Anemia Correction in Chronic Renal Failure) is fully

enrolled with over 475 non-dialysis patients from over 70 sites in the United States.

"We are delighted that the rate of enrollment exceeded our expectations for this trial," said Anne-Marie Duliege, M.D., chief medical officer at Affymax. "The completion of enrollment in our first Phase 3 trial for Hematide is significant and moves us closer to our ultimate goal of providing a once-monthly treatment alternative for the many patients with anemia associated with chronic renal failure. We continue to target completion of enrollment in the other three Phase 3 trials in our pivotal program by year end 2008. We believe this will lead to composite results, with data from all four studies, in early 2010. Consistent with our previous guidance, we expect to submit a New Drug Application for Hematide in chronic renal failure in 2010 if all goes as planned."

The Hematide Phase 3 program, involving a total of approximately 2,400 chronic renal failure patients, consists of four open-label, randomized controlled clinical trials in the U.S. and Europe, including two trials in patients on dialysis and two trials in patients not on dialysis. The trials in non-dialysis patients, called PEARL 1 and PEARL 2, are evaluating the safety and efficacy of Hematide compared to darbepoetin alfa in correcting anemia and maintaining hemoglobin levels over time.

In dialysis patients, the trials, called EMERALD 1 and EMERALD 2, are evaluating the safety and efficacy of Hematide and its ability to maintain hemoglobin levels in a corrected range when patients are switched from epoetin alfa or epoetin beta to Hematide.

Analysis of efficacy for each study is based on assessments of non-inferiority to the comparator drugs. The primary efficacy endpoint is the mean change in hemoglobin from baseline. The hemoglobin target range is 11-12 g/dL for studies in non-dialysis patients and 10-12 g/dL for studies in dialysis patients. In all studies, Hematide is dosed once every four weeks while comparator drugs are dosed in accordance with their respective product labels. Treatment in each study is planned until the last patient has been treated for approximately 52 weeks. Assessment of safety will include an analysis of non-inferiority to comparator drugs using a composite cardiovascular endpoint from a safety database pooled from all four Phase 3 trials. The duration of the Phase 3 trials assumes observance of a sufficient number of safety events for statistical analysis.

About Hematide

Hematide is a novel synthetic, PEGylated peptidic compound that binds to and activates the erythropoietin receptor and thus acts as an erythropoiesis stimulating agent (ESA).

Affymax and Takeda Pharmaceutical Company Limited are collaborating on the development of Hematide and plan to co-commercialize the product in the United States. The product, upon approval, will be commercialized in the European Union by Takeda. Affymax is conducting Phase 3 clinical trials for Hematide to treat anemia associated with chronic renal failure and Takeda initiated a Phase 1 clinical trial in the U.S. to evaluate Hematide to treat chemotherapy-induced anemia in prostate, breast and non-small cell lung cancer patients.

About Anemia in Chronic Renal Failure (CRF)

Anemia in CRF affects many individuals with Chronic Kidney Disease (CKD). According to the National Kidney Foundation, 20 million Americans - 1 in 9 U.S. adults - have CKD. Anemia develops in the early stages of CKD and worsens as patients progress towards total kidney failure and need a dialysis machine to eliminate waste and water from their blood. In severe or prolonged cases of anemia, the lack of oxygen in the blood can cause serious and sometimes fatal damage to the heart and other organs. Benefits of anemia correction in patients with CKD include decreased morbidity, hospitalization, and mortality.(1)
